OSATE&AADL 建模入门学习教程:错误树分析 (FTA) 样例
2023-11-24 02:38:58
错误树分析经典方法
当人们考虑安全时,最简单的问题之一就是:“什么可能会出错?” 而这是一个有效的提问方式。 本篇博客是我们错误树分析 (FTA) 系列的第二部分。在第一部分中,我们介绍了 FTA 的基本概念,而在本部分中,我们将通过一个示例来演练如何执行 FTA 分析。
介绍:
欢迎来到错误树分析 (FTA) 样例。
在上一篇关于 FTA 的文章中,我们了解了 FTA 的基本概念,包括: - FTA 是一种用于分析潜在故障场景的技术。 - 它是通过构建一个“树”来完成的,其中根事件是顶层的事件,而可能导致该事件的其他事件是树的子节点。 - 分析师从根事件开始工作,并继续添加子节点,直到他们创建了一棵完整的树,其中包含所有可能导致根事件的事件。
在本示例中,我们将使用 OSATE 和 AADL 建模工具来执行 FTA。我们使用的工具版本是 OSATE 2.0.2 和 AADL 2.0。
**步骤:**
1. **创建一个新的 AADL 项目。**- 打开 OSATE,然后单击“文件”>“新建”>“项目”。 - 在“新建项目”对话框中,选择“AADL 项目”模板,然后单击“下一步”。 - 在“项目名称”字段中,输入项目名称(例如,“FTA 示例”)。 - 在“项目位置”字段中,输入项目的位置(例如,“C:\Users\[你的用户名]\Desktop\FTA 示例”)。 - 单击“完成”以创建项目。
- 导入 AADL 模型。
- 右键单击项目名称,然后选择“导入”。 - 在“导入”对话框中,选择“文件系统”作为导入源。 - 在“源文件夹”字段中,输入模型文件的位置(例如,“C:\Users\[你的用户名]\Downloads\FTA 示例.aadl”)。 - 单击“确定”以导入模型。
- 创建一个新的 FTA 分析。
- 右键单击模型名称,然后选择“新建”>“错误树分析”。 - 在“新建错误树分析”对话框中,输入分析名称(例如,“FTA 示例”)。 - 单击“确定”以创建分析。
- 添加根事件。
- 在 FTA 分析中,右键单击“根事件”节点,然后选择“添加事件”。 - 在“添加事件”对话框中,输入事件名称(例如,“系统故障”)。 - 单击“确定”以添加事件。
- 添加子事件。
- 右键单击根事件,然后选择“添加子事件”。 - 在“添加子事件”对话框中,输入子事件名称(例如,“硬件故障”)。 - 单击“确定”以添加子事件。 - 重复此步骤以添加更多子事件。
- 链接事件。
- 右键单击一个事件,然后选择“链接事件”。 - 在“链接事件”对话框中,选择要链接到的事件。 - 单击“确定”以链接事件。 - 重复此步骤以链接更多事件。
- 生成报告。
- 右键单击 FTA 分析,然后选择“生成报告”。 - 在“生成报告”对话框中,选择报告格式(例如,“HTML”)。 - 单击“确定”以生成报告。
- 分析报告。
- 打开生成的报告。 - 查看报告以了解 FTA 分析结果。
错误树分析是一个强大的工具,可用于分析潜在的故障场景。本教程只是 FTA 过程的简单介绍。有许多其他资源可用于帮助您学习更多有关 FTA 的信息。
我们建议您在使用 FTA 之前阅读这些资源。FTA 是一种复杂的技术,但它对于确保系统的安全和可靠性非常重要。
**摘要:**
FTA 是一种用于分析潜在故障场景的技术。它通过构建一个“树”来完成,其中根事件是顶层的事件,而可能导致该事件的其他事件是树的子节点。分析师从根事件开始工作,并继续添加子节点,直到他们创建了一棵完整的树,其中包含所有可能导致根事件的事件。
FTA 是一种强大的工具,可用于分析潜在的故障场景。本教程只是 FTA 过程的简单介绍。有许多其他资源可用于帮助您学习更多有关 FTA 的信息。
我们建议您在使用 FTA 之前阅读这些资源。FTA 是一种复杂的技术,但它对于确保系统的安全和可靠性非常重要。